How to choose a instrument Discord server

Picking the right instrument server is about fit, not just size. A few signals make the choice easier:

  • Compare the online count to total members — a healthy online ratio is the clearest sign of real day-to-day activity.
  • Read the description and rules to confirm the focus and tone match what you want.
  • Skim the tags and recent activity to check the conversation is current and on-topic.
  • Smaller, well-moderated communities are often friendlier to newcomers than the largest servers.

Safety & moderation notes

Stick to servers with clear rules, visible moderators, and a verification step on join. Be cautious with unsolicited DMs, never share account logins or click suspicious "free Nitro" links, keep personal information private, and use the report tools if anyone makes you uncomfortable.

Instrument Discord Server FAQs

What should I look for in Instrument Discord servers?

Check how active the server is, whether rules are clear, and if the channel structure matches what you want to discuss.

How can I choose a good Instrument community quickly?

Compare listing descriptions, online member counts, and recent activity. A clear listing with steady conversation is usually easier to join.

Are Instrument Discord servers free to join?

Most listed servers are free to join. Some communities may offer optional premium roles or perks.

Do tags guarantee server quality?

Tags help narrow the topic, but quality still depends on moderation, member behavior, and consistent activity.
